Do IE hotifixes/patches affect Avant Browser?

Although Avant Browser runs it's own IEXPLORE.EXE, it says that it uses IE's core engine. If so, does this mean that hotfixes/patches applied to IE are automatically inherited by Avant Browser?

Yes, as far as I can tell. I could (easily) be wrong.
Avant, which I use, is primarily just IE with a different skin and a bunch
more tools.
